Cville Bike to Work Week: Tuesday Bike Bus and Appreciation Stations

May 16, 2023 @ 7:45 am – 9:00 am

Interested in biking to work (or wherever you go) but afraid to try it? Looking for safety in numbers? Do you simply enjoy meeting–and riding with–other people?

Join this moderately-paced group ride that will cross town, picking up and dropping off cyclists along the way as we bike to work. Like a bus, the group will make scheduled stops and riders are free to come and go as best suits their travel needs.

Here’s the route [View Map]:

7:45 a.m. The Wool Factory (1837 Broadway Street)
7:50 a.m. Riverview Park
8:00 a.m. Meade Park
8:15 a.m. Downtown (The Piedmont Environmental Council, 410 East Water Street)*
8:30 a.m. The Rotunda
8:45 a.m. UVA Facilities (Skipwith Hall, 1490 Leake Drive)*

*There will be Bike to Work Appreciation Stations at The Piedmont Environmental Council (snacks from Blue Ridge Country Store!) and at Skipwith Hall, with snacks, swag and lots of encouragement!

Although one need not be an expert cyclist, riders will be expected to have a bike that is in good working order and be able to maintain a moderate pace. This “bike bus” is a commute to work, so we’re hoping to make sure everyone arrives on time to their workplace destinations!
